## Deployment

Graphlet renders the dependency graph for all Marrowby services. It deploys as a single pod per region; restart it if graphs stop updating, as the crawler occasionally wedges on cyclic manifests. No state to migrate — the graph rebuilds from scratch on boot, which takes about four minutes. The crawler starts with these configuration values:

service settings:
[silwyn]
host = silwyn.crelvogrid.internal
user = silwyn_svc
database = silwyn_prod

Management Meeting Minutes — Headcount Plan

Attendees reviewed the draft headcount plan for Brellan Logistics. Net growth of twelve roles was approved in principle, weighted toward the Northgate depot and the dispatch automation team. Branch managers must submit role justifications within two weeks. The broader rationale for this allocation is recorded in the note below.

internal memo for hahif-hahaf: Headcount on the Zorwyn team goes from 9 to 100 by the end of October. Gross margin on Zorwyn came in at 5 percent against a plan of 10 percent.

Handover Note — Locker Assignments. Hi Priya, before I head off: the changing-room lockers at Northgate House are now tracked on the shared spreadsheet, not the paper ledger. Rows 1–40 are assigned to Calloway Freight staff; rows 41–60 are pool lockers, first come first served. Marek from the cycling group has asked for two adjacent lockers — fine to approve once 44 is vacated Friday. The master locker cabinet in the facilities office is kept locked; to open it, use the code below.

turnstile pass: bdg-TXR-4